Accessing the device for the first time
Connecting the console cable
CAUTION:
•
To connect a PC to an operating device, first connect the PC end. To disconnect a PC from an
operating device, first disconnect the device end.
•
If the PC does not have a RS-232 serial port but has a USB port, use a USB-to-RS-232 converter
and install the corresponding driver for console cable connection.
To connect the console cable, connect the DB-9 connector (female) of the console cable to the
RS-232 serial port on the configuration terminal and the RJ-45 connector to the console port of the
device.

Setting configuration terminal parameters
To configure and manage the device through the console port, you must run a terminal emulator
program on your PC. You can use the emulator program to connect a network device, a Telnet site,
or an SSH site. For more information about the terminal emulator programs, see the user guides for
these programs.
Configure the configuration terminal parameters as follows:
•
Baud rate
—9600.
•
Data bits
—8.
•
Stop bits
—1.
•
Parity
—none.
•
Flow control
—none.
